Dithiolethione Compounds Inhibit Akt Signaling in Human Breast and Lung Cancer Cells by Increasing PP2A Activity
The chemo-preventative effects of dithiolethione compounds are attributed to their activation of anti-oxidant response elements (ARE) by reacting with the Nrf2/Keap1 protein complex.
